Fabry Perot Etalon 644 nm

Product Overview

A Fabry P?rot etalon for optical filtering and generation of interference rings in the normal Zeeman effect experiment. The fixed etalon?consists of a substrate with a double sided partially reflective mirror coating of high reflectivity.?The substrate and mirrors form an optical resonator which fulfils the resonance conditions of the red cadmium line (? = 644 nm). The tilt of the etalon to the optical axis can be adjusted with three adjustment screws in the housing allowing the displayed pattern of interference rings to be shifted horizontally and vertically. Wavelength range: 644 nm Substrate material: Suprasil Refractive index: 1 4567 Coefficient of reflection: 0 85 Flatness: 32 nm (?/20) Aperture: 22 mm External diameter: 130 mm Diameter of rod: 10 mm Height from end of rod to optical axis: 150 mm
